1. What is the Application Scenario?
Website
You own a website and wish to provide your users with a form where they can type in URL's and
have these websites translated into another language. In this case you need to select "Website"
as your application scenario. Next, enter the domain name you want to register with the URL Translator.
Please note that the URL Translator will only work with that domain name.
Desktop
You need a form on your computer, where you can enter URL's and have these websites translated into
another language. In this case, select "Desktop" as your application scenario. You will receive a link
to your dedicated translator to launch the URL Translator whenever you need it.
2. What are the differences between the various Support Levels?
Bronze - Minimum technical support. Customers may use this FAQ to resolve the issue at hand or contact WorldLingo support using the online contact form, and a reply will be received within 10 business days. Some additional costs may occur for customization of service: $50/hour for standard rules (Custom dictionary, Domain name masking, Translation of user data), and $150/hour for customization issues (Custom ad banner, Custom style, logins, etc).
Silver - Medium technical support. Customers can contact WorldLingo using the dedicated online form in their account and a reply will be received within 48hrs. Customers may also use this FAQ to resolve the issue at hand. Customers can also receive usage statistics upon request. Some additional costs may occur for customization of service: $50/hour for standard rules (Custom dictionary, Domain name masking, Translation of user data), and $150/hour for customization issues (Custom ad banner, Custom style, logins, etc).
Gold - Maximum technical support. Customers can contact WorldLingo using the dedicated online form in their account and a reply will be received within 24hrs. Customers may also use this FAQ to resolve the issue at hand. Customers can also receive usage statistics upon request. Technical support for standard rules and customization will not be charged (within reasonable use).
3. I am not sure if the limit I chose for the number of translations per month will be enough. What happens if I go over?
The basic service comes with 1,000 translation requests per month; however we offer 3 higher limits: 2,500, 10,000 and 100,000 translations. If the limit is reached before the end of the month, an email will be sent to WorldLingo Customer Support and we will contact you to upgrade the subscription for the following months. If you upgrade, the "limit exceeded" counter will reset to 0. If you decide not to upgrade and this situation occurs again, the service will stop functioning once the monthly limit has been reached.
4. What is the "Number of words per translation" limit?
Our URL Translator performs the translations by batches of words. These batches can be of 4 different sizes: 500 (basic service), 1,000, 2,500 and 5,000 words. If the limit is reached before the end of the page, an "End of translation" icon will appear and by clicking on it, the URL will translate the next batch of words.
5. When I click on the "End of translation" icon, does that count as 1 translation?
Yes.
6. If I hit the back button to access the previous translation, does this count as 1 translation?
No, because it is till in the browser memory. If you close your browser or refresh the page, it will then count as a new translation.

8. Can I remove all WorldLingo branding?
There are 3 instances of branding that comes with the URL translator:
- The logo on the URL translator form can be removed by going to Modify › Optional › WorldLingo logo Option
- The ad banner on the translated pages can be removed by going to Modify › Optional › Translation Details Size
- By customizing the entire form to adapt it to your website. For this, go to Modify › Optional › Style
